哈希趣投游戏系统开发,从概念到实现哈希趣投游戏系统开发

哈希趣投游戏系统开发,从概念到实现哈希趣投游戏系统开发,

本文目录导读:

  1. 哈希趣投游戏系统概述
  2. 哈希趣投游戏系统的技术架构设计
  3. 哈希趣投游戏系统的功能设计
  4. 哈希趣投游戏系统的测试与优化
  5. 哈希趣投游戏系统的总结与展望

随着科技的飞速发展,游戏化应用越来越受到关注,尤其是在投资领域,如何通过游戏化的形式吸引投资者,提升投资体验,成为一个备受关注的话题,本文将介绍如何开发一款以投资为主题的趣投游戏系统——哈希趣投游戏系统,通过从概念到实现的详细分析,探讨如何将复杂的金融知识转化为有趣的游戏体验,同时实现高参与度和高活跃度的用户群体。

哈希趣投游戏系统概述

1 系统背景

哈希趣投游戏系统是一款以投资为主题的互动式游戏平台,旨在通过游戏化的方式帮助用户更好地理解投资知识,提升投资决策能力,与传统的投资理财方式不同,哈希趣投游戏系统将金融知识融入游戏场景中,让用户在游戏中学习,在游戏中盈利。

2 系统目标

  1. 提供一个寓教于乐的投资学习平台;
  2. 增强用户的投资意识和投资能力;
  3. 提高用户对投资的兴趣和参与度;
  4. 实现高活跃度和高盈利的用户群体。

哈希趣投游戏系统的技术架构设计

1 系统总体架构

哈希趣投游戏系统的总体架构分为前端和后端两部分,前端部分负责游戏场景的构建、用户界面的展示以及游戏逻辑的实现;后端部分负责数据的存储、用户身份认证、支付处理等功能。

2 前端架构

前端架构基于React框架,采用Vue.js进行组件化开发,前端主要负责游戏场景的构建、用户界面的展示以及互动逻辑的实现,前端架构采用分层设计,将场景分为多个独立的组件,每个组件负责特定的功能模块。

3 后端架构

后端架构基于Node.js和MongoDB进行开发,后端主要负责数据的存储、用户身份认证、支付处理等功能,后端架构采用RESTful API设计,支持多线程处理和数据异步操作。

4 数据库设计

数据库采用MongoDB进行设计,支持非结构化数据存储,主要存储用户信息、投资记录、游戏场景数据等,通过MongoDB的特性,可以轻松实现数据的动态扩展和高效查询。

哈希趣投游戏系统的功能设计

1 投资知识学习

用户可以通过游戏化的形式学习投资相关的知识,例如股票、基金、债券等,系统提供知识卡片、互动问答、模拟交易等学习模块,帮助用户逐步掌握投资知识。

2 投资策略制定

用户可以通过系统提供的策略制定工具,制定自己的投资策略,系统支持多种策略类型,包括价值投资、成长投资、价值成长混合策略等,用户可以根据市场趋势和自身风险偏好选择合适的策略。

3 投资交易执行

用户可以通过系统提供的交易模块,进行虚拟的股票、基金等投资交易,系统支持订单管理、仓位管理、收益计算等功能,帮助用户实时跟踪投资结果。

4 社交互动

用户可以通过系统提供的社交模块,与其他用户进行互动,用户可以查看其他用户的交易记录、投资策略,并参与讨论,提升游戏体验。

5 奖励机制

用户在系统中表现优异时,可以触发奖励机制,获得虚拟货币、游戏道具等奖励,奖励机制可以激励用户积极参与游戏,提升用户粘性。

哈希趣投游戏系统的测试与优化

1 功能测试

系统功能测试分为单元测试、集成测试和系统测试,单元测试负责各个功能模块的独立测试;集成测试负责功能模块之间的协同测试;系统测试负责整个系统的稳定性测试。

2 性能优化

系统在开发过程中注重性能优化,采用多线程、异步操作等方式提升系统运行效率,通过优化数据库查询、减少网络请求等方式提升系统性能。

3 用户体验优化

用户体验优化主要从界面设计、操作流程、反馈机制等方面入手,通过优化界面设计,提升用户操作体验;通过优化操作流程,减少用户学习成本;通过反馈机制,及时了解用户需求,提升用户体验。

哈希趣投游戏系统的总结与展望

1 开发总结

通过开发哈希趣投游戏系统,我们深刻体会到,一个成功的游戏化应用需要前端和后端的紧密配合,数据管理和用户体验设计的双重考虑,我们也认识到开发过程中的不足之处,例如系统功能的扩展性不足、用户体验的个性化需求有待进一步提升。

2 未来展望

我们计划进一步优化系统功能,增加更多投资相关的知识模块;提升用户体验,增加更多社交互动和个性化推荐;扩展应用场景,将投资知识应用到其他领域,如房地产、汽车等。

哈希趣投游戏系统开发是一项复杂而艰巨的任务,但也是一项充满挑战和机遇的事业,通过系统的开发和优化,我们希望能够为用户提供一个有趣且富有教育意义的投资游戏平台,同时为投资教育领域带来新的可能性,我们将继续探索,不断提升系统的功能和用户体验,为用户提供更优质的投资游戏体验。

哈希趣投游戏系统开发,从概念到实现哈希趣投游戏系统开发,

发表评论